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of a specialized material designed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ings. This process typically includes assessing the property’s specific needs, selecting the appropriate vapor barrier type, and installing it in areas prone to moisture issues. The installation aims to create a barrier that reduces the transfer of moisture from the ground or surrounding environment into indoor spaces, helping to maintain a dry and stable interior environment.
One of the primary problems vapor barriers help address is excess moisture buildup, which can lead to iss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. In properties where moisture infiltration is a concern, especially in basements, crawl spaces, or concrete slabs, vapor barriers serve as a preventative measure to protect the integrity of the building. Proper installation can also improve indoor air quality by reducing humidity levels that foster mold and mildew development.

Professional vapor barrier installation involves working with various materials such as polyethylene sheeting, foil-backed products, or other specialized membranes. The selection of the appropriate vapor barrier depends on the property’s specific conditions and the location of installation.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ality chosen. For a standard basement, material expenses can vary between $100 and $300.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. Total labor costs for an average project may range from $200 to $600, based on size and complexity.
Project Size Impact - Larger areas tend to increase overall costs, with projects over 1,000 square feet often reaching $1,000 or more. Smaller projects may be completed for under $300 in total expenses.
Additional Costs - Extra services such as surface preparation or sealing can add $50 to $200 to the total. These costs vary depending on the existing condition of the installation site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ity and reduce mold risk.
Where should v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ers are typically installed in areas like basements, crawl spaces, and under concrete slabs to protect against mo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heets, foil-backed membranes, and specialized vapor retarders designed for specific applications.
